Catégories

Convertisseur Hex/Unicode

Convertir les caractères vers/depuis séquences d'échappement hex (\xXX) et Unicode (\uXXXX)

Points clés

Catégorie
Format Conversion
Types d’entrée
textarea, select
Type de sortie
text
Couverture des échantillons
4
API disponible
Yes

Vue d’ensemble

Le Convertisseur Hex/Unicode est un outil en ligne qui permet de convertir du texte en séquences d'échappement hexadécimales (\xXX) et Unicode (\uXXXX), et inversement. Idéal pour les développeurs et professionnels travaillant avec des encodages de caractères.

Quand l’utiliser

  • Lorsque vous devez encoder du texte pour l'intégrer dans du code source nécessitant des séquences d'échappement.
  • Pour décoder des chaînes hexadécimales ou Unicode provenant de fichiers, logs ou données.
  • Quand vous avez besoin de convertir des caractères entre formats pour des raisons de compatibilité ou de lisibilité.

Comment ça marche

  • Entrez ou collez le texte à convertir dans la zone de texte prévue.
  • Sélectionnez l'opération souhaitée : conversion vers hex, depuis hex, vers Unicode, ou depuis Unicode.
  • Choisissez le format de sortie : avec préfixe (\xXX, \uXXXX), compact (XX, XXXX), ou tableau.
  • Le résultat s'affiche instantanément, prêt à être copié ou utilisé.

Cas d’usage

Encoder des chaînes pour des scripts de programmation en JavaScript, Python ou autres langages.
Décoder des messages échappés dans des fichiers de configuration ou des journaux d'application.
Convertir des caractères pour l'affichage dans des systèmes utilisant des formats d'échappement spécifiques.

Exemples

1. Encoder du texte en hexadécimal pour un script

Contexte
Un développeur web doit inclure une chaîne avec des guillemets dans un attribut HTML généré par JavaScript.
Problème
Les guillemets doivent être échappés pour éviter les erreurs de syntaxe.
Comment l’utiliser
Entrez le texte 'C'est un "test".' dans le champ d'entrée, sélectionnez 'Convertir en Hex' et le format 'Avec Préfixe'.
Résultat
Le texte est converti en : \x43\x27\x65\x73\x74\x20\x75\x6e\x20\x22\x74\x65\x73\x74\x22\x2e

2. Décoder des séquences Unicode dans un fichier

Contexte
Un analyste reçoit un export de données avec des caractères échappés en Unicode.
Problème
Il a besoin de lire les noms originaux pour un rapport.
Comment l’utiliser
Copiez les séquences comme \u004a\u006f\u0068\u006e dans le champ, choisissez 'Convertir depuis Unicode' et le format 'Avec Préfixe'.
Résultat
Les séquences sont décodées en 'John', rendant le texte lisible.

Tester avec des échantillons

image, text

Hubs associés

FAQ

Quelles opérations de conversion sont disponibles ?

L'outil supporte la conversion vers et depuis les séquences d'échappement hex (\xXX) et Unicode (\uXXXX).

Puis-je convertir des caractères spéciaux ou accentués ?

Oui, l'outil gère tous les caractères Unicode, y compris les accents et symboles.

Quels formats de sortie sont proposés ?

Vous pouvez choisir entre le format avec préfixe (\xXX, \uXXXX), le format compact (XX, XXXX), ou le format tableau.

L'outil est-il gratuit et sécurisé ?

Oui, cet outil est entièrement gratuit et le traitement est effectué côté client, sans envoi de données.

Comment décoder une chaîne avec des séquences mixtes ?

Utilisez l'opération appropriée, comme 'Convertir depuis Hex' pour les séquences hex, et l'outil gérera le texte environnant.

Documentation de l'API

Point de terminaison de la requête

POST /fr/api/tools/hex-unicode-converter

Paramètres de la requête

Nom du paramètre Type Requis Description
inputText textarea Oui -
operation select Non -
format select Non -

Format de réponse

{
  "result": "Processed text content",
  "error": "Error message (optional)",
  "message": "Notification message (optional)",
  "metadata": {
    "key": "value"
  }
}
Texte: Texte

Documentation de MCP

Ajoutez cet outil à votre configuration de serveur MCP:

{
  "mcpServers": {
    "elysiatools-hex-unicode-converter": {
      "name": "hex-unicode-converter",
      "description": "Convertir les caractères vers/depuis séquences d'échappement hex (\xXX) et Unicode (\uXXXX)",
      "baseUrl": "https://elysiatools.com/mcp/sse?toolId=hex-unicode-converter",
      "command": "",
      "args": [],
      "env": {},
      "isActive": true,
      "type": "sse"
    }
  }
}

Vous pouvez chaîner plusieurs outils, par ex.: `https://elysiatools.com/mcp/sse?toolId=png-to-webp,jpg-to-webp,gif-to-webp`, max 20 outils.

Si vous rencontrez des problèmes, veuillez nous contacter à [email protected]